SED 661 Coop. Lrn. Spec. Needs. Studen

This course focuses on promoting student achievement and development in a collaborative learning community. Communication skills for effective teaching in an inclusive or special education setting are described, modeled and then practiced by course participants. Through the lens of cooperative learning, participants will focus on the following topics: curriculum development, planning and behavior management, instructional planning, and differentiating instruction. Improving students? social competence and the acquisition of functional living skills will be explored. In addition, participants will demonstrate effective collaborations among teachers and other professionals and discover ways to establish partnerships with families and community.
